"nightjar" meaning in English

See nightjar in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/ˈnaɪtd͡ʒɑː/ [Received-Pronunciation], /ˈnaɪtd͡ʒɑɹ/ [General-American] Forms: nightjars [plural]
Etymology: From night + jar, churr (“a sound, chirp, cry”). Etymology templates: {{com|en|night|jar}} night + jar Head templates: {{en-noun}} nightjar (plural nightjars)
  1. Any of various medium-sized nocturnal birds of the family Caprimulgidae, that feed predominantly on moths and other large flying insects.
